S IMMO BUY (unchanged) Target: Euro 6.50 (unchanged) 23 November 2012 Price (Euro) 4.90 52 weeks range 5.03 / 3.88 Key Data Country Austria Industry Real Estate Market Segment Prime Market ISIN AT0000652250 WKN 902388 Symbol T1L Reuters SIAG.VI Bloomberg SPI:AV Internet www.simmoag.at Reporting Standard IFRS Fiscal Year 31/12 Founded 1986 IPO 1987 Market Cap (EUR million) 333.8 Number of shares (million) 68.1 Free Float (approx.) 81% Free Float MarketCap (Euro million) 270.4 CAGR (net profit 11-14e) -1.3% Multiples 2011 2012e 2013e 2014e P/S-Ratio 1.6 1.7 1.8 1.8 P/E-Ratio 16.7 17.0 20.0 17.4 Dividend Yield 2.0% 2.0% 2.0% 2.0% Key Data per Share (Euro) 2011 2012e 2013e 2014e Earnings per Share (EpS) 0.29 0.29 0.25 0.28 Dividends per Share (DpS) 0.10 0.10 0.10 0.10 Book Value per Share (BVpS) 6.96 7.25 7.49 7.77 NAV per share 6.96 7.07 7.21 7.36 FFO per share 0.42 0.47 0.48 0.48 Financial Data (Euro '000) 2011 2012e 2013e 2014e Revenues 207,812 191,536 185,857 188,443 Rental income 125,943 114,487 111,052 112,718 Net revaluation result 146 5,800 2,000 3,000 Operating cash profit (EBITDA) 101,406 95,314 91,023 92,373 Operating Profit (EBIT) 92,286 91,920 84,287 86,516 Pre-tax profit (EBT) 29,643 24,746 21,566 25,287 Net profit after minorities 20,034 19,591 16,714 19,235 Shareholders' Equity 474,042 493,626 510,333 529,561 RoE after tax 4.2% 4.0% 3.3% 3.7% Financial Calendar Preliminaries 2012 Annual report 2012 1Q 2013 AGM 2Q 2013 3Q 2013 Main Shareholders Vienna Insurance Group 10% Erste Bank Group 10% Analysts Internet March 26, 2013 April 25, 2013 May 23, 2013 June 12, 2013 August 27, 2013 November 21, 2013 André Hüsemann, CREA Stefan Scharff, CREA Fon: +49-(0)69 400 313-79 and -80 scharff@src-research.de andre.huesemann@src-research.de www.src-research.de www.aktienmarkt-international.at Sound numbers, management continues its strategy to step up earnings power Yesterday, S IMMO posted its 9M 2012 numbers which were very convincing. Despite predominant disposal activities of the recent quarters, rental income decreased only slightly by 2.5% to Euro 89.5m (9M 2012: 91.8m). The gross margin in the property segment was pleasant at 56.9% (55.6%). General KPIs also develop according to plan. At present, occupancy is at a satisfying 93.2% (91.8%), LTV improved significantly to 54% (58%) and EPRA NAV increased to 9.02 Euro per share (9M 2011: 8.64 Euro). However, due to opportunistic sales of properties above their book value in Austria and Germany, number of objects within the portfolio clearly decreased from 239 in the last year to 218 by now, while portfolio value dropped from Euro 1,988m to Euro 1,856m. By end of 9M 2012, sales volume of disposals amounted to Euro 130m, compared to their book value of Euro 120m, translating into an average upside on book value of 8%. By now, there are no further properties held for disposal on the company s balance sheet. In addition, the management claimed in the conference call only a low likelihood for further disposals this year, but more to come next year. The guidance remains to dispose 5% of the portfolio value per year. In fact, as long as the financial crisis lasts and interest costs remain low we assume the present price level for commercial and residential real estate to increase further or at least stay on the current level, which is indeed an advantageous environment for property sellers in Germany and Austria. The average cost of funding for S IMMO is also low at 4.57% (4.80%) and results in lower interest expenses. Property revaluation accounted for Euro 5.5m (Euro 4.3m), confirming the positive trend of the past quarters. We assume in particular Austria and Germany to contribute positive results, while CEE and also SEE seem to be stable for S IMMO. However, when four new shopping malls open in the next months in Sofia, the local market for retail and office could experience a severe pressure on rents and revaluation there. The hotel segment at S IMMO also runs according to plan and generated a pleasant GOP of Euro 6.2m (Euro 6.9m). All in all, the company reported an excellent bottom line result after minorities and tax of Euro 19.3m (Euro 16.6m). The high FFO-yield of 10.2% and the share price discount of 47% to the EPRA NAV justify a higher valuation than the current share price, particularly when compared to peers. Therefore we maintain our Buy-rating and our target price of 6.50 Euros.

Industry: Real Estate Management Board: Sub segment: mixed Ernst Vejdovszky Country: Austria Friedrich Wachernig, MBA Headquarter: Vienna Holger Schmidtmayr, MRICS Foundation: 1986 Employees (without Hotels): 89 Supervisory Board: Dr. Martin Simhandl (Chairman) Dr. Gerald Antonitsch Franz Kerber Christian Hager Erwin Hammerbacher IR Contact Michael Matlin, MBA Dr. Wilhelm Rasinger Dr. Sylwia Milke Dr. Ralf Zeitlberger (Sylwia.Milke@simmoag.at) S IMMO is a Vienna based real estate holding company founded 1986. Since 1987 the company is listed on the Vienna stock exchange and therefore Austria s longest standing property investment company. First acquisitions and activities started in Austria. Expansion activities to foreign countries were started close to the millenium. Within recent years the company acquired, according to its Buy and Hold strategy, a real estate portfolio that comprises more than 200 properties, a lettable space of some 1,300k sqm amounting to a value of Euro 1.9bn in 2012. In average, investments have a volume of a lower double digit million. The portfolio contains a widely diversified range of residential, office, business and hotel properties selected for sustainable value. S IMMO aims on a long investment horizon and majority participations. In terms of portfolio value a large share of approx. 26% is located in Germany. Austria accounts for almost 33% while SEE stands for 21% and CEE for 20% of total portfolio value (2012). Looking at the tenant structure it is very granulated in terms of rental income. The Top 20 tenants stand only for 25% of rental income (excluding hotels with management contracts). Of these 86% have a lease term structure of more than 5 years. Half of them even more than 10 years. Furthermore the company has development activities in Austria and CEE/SEE region which are on account of the economical situation on hold at present. The lion s share of the company s historically development activity was done here. Hence, a significant share of already finished properties, held within the CEE/ SEE portfolio, results from own development. The occupancy rate of the total portfolio is at 93% providing a stable rental income while the gross rental yield is at 6.9% for the total portfolio (3Q 2012). The core shareholders are Erste Bank Group (10% of shares) and Vienna Insurance Group (10%). Erste Bank is an Austrian retail bank founded 1819 with a client base of some 17m customers. Vienna Insurance Group is an Austrian insurance company, located in Vienna and since September 2008 among shareholders. Hence, S IMMO has two of the largest financial service providers of Austria and CEE as core shareholder which is definetely a source of long term strength for the company and its future development. Furthermore we assume an easier access in terms of financing. Source: Company Data, SRC Research 2 2 SRC Equity Research

SWOT Analysis Strengths The firm has a well diversified portfolio with a total of approx. 218 properties and a rental space of ~ 1,300k sqm amounting to a value of Euro 1.9bn. The properties are located across eight countries. A focus is on Germany and Austria (60% of portfolio) while the other countries are located in CEE and SEE (20% each), thus geographical diversification is high. Furthermore the portfolio is well diversified in terms of its type of use. Residential (22%), office (39%), retail (26%) and hotels (14%) are covered, thus all major types are under one roof. In addition, all shares of each sector are quite balanced. However we assume that this kind of portfolio will attract more the general equity investors than specialized investors that might be more focused on Pure-Plays. The present share price level offers a huge discount of some 50% to the EPRA NAV of Euro 9.02 after 3Q 12 (year-end 2011: Euro 8.70), even after the record year 2011. The occupancy rate slightly improved again to a very comfortable 93.2% providing a stable rental income (yield 6.9%) while the LTV of reduced to 54% and is supposed to reduce to 50% in mid-term. Two of the largest financial services firms in Austria, Erste Bank and Vienna Insurance, are the largest shareholders accounting for 10% each of the shares. Both shareholders have a positive effect on the business Granulated tenant structure. The top 25 tenants count only for 40% of yearly rental income. Furthermore the majority of rental contracts are long-term. Both shopping centers Sun and Serdika in Bulgaria and Romania are now fully let (the shopping space) Weaknesses Although S IMMO is present on the stock market since 1987 the awareness for the success story at the equity markets is still not too high in our view as the market cap is split between the S IMMO share and the two participation certificates. There are participation certificates in the financing structure with a hybrid character between equity and liability. This form of financing is unusual to many international investors. Thus we liked the plan of S IMMO to tender these papers into normal equity stock shares until year-end 2011 in three steps. Unfortunately there was no 75% majority for this proposal on the AGM. Now S IMMO aims to buy back a larger share of participating certificates. It is intended to buy back a share of 15% of circulating participating certificates. Opportunities The repurchasing program of participating certificates lowers the share of payments to certificate holders and offers the opportunity to pay out a dividend. First dividend payment of Euro 0.10 was on 15 June. S IMMO realized a huge premium on their disposals of some 5% to 10% in 2012. In contrast to that the stock trades with a discount of approx. 50% to its EPRA NAV. Threats Austria lost its S&P AAA rating mainly due to its high engagement in CEE and SEE. Due to higher restrictions for credits in those regions, higher refinancing costs and higher equity requirements and stricter covenants are very likely to occur. S IMMO faced unpaid rents at Sun Plaza and Serdika Center comprising a volume of approx. Euro 8m in 2011. For 2012 we expect an improvement here. As being active in eight countries the firm might face non-cash P & L losses due to an unfavorable development of currencies. In particular a weak Euro against Hungarian Forint and Czech Crown caused non-cash foreign exchange losses in 1H 12 of -1.8m. 3 3 SRC Equity Research
